    What causes a high-pressure fault in Zodiac Z200 M3, and how to resolve it?
    • B
      Brent BlackburnAug 17, 2025
      A high-pressure fault in your Zodiac Heat Pump can be caused by air and water emulsion entering the device; in this case, check the pool's hydraulic circuit. Increase flow using the bypass and ensure the pool filter isn't clogged. Wait for the temperature to fall. Check the flow controller, clean the water condenser, and close the bypass valve to increase the flow rate through the device.

    What does 'Deicing cycle fault (>20 minutes)' mean on my Zodiac Z200 M3 Heat Pump and how can I fix it?
    • T
      Timothy OlsonAug 20, 2025
      A deicing cycle fault lasting more than 20 minutes on your Zodiac Heat Pump could be due to a low air temperature; wait until the temperature is within the operating range. Alternatively, clean the evaporator.

    Why does my Zodiac Heat Pump trip the circuit breaker?
    • R
      Ronnie PetersonAug 30, 2025
      The Zodiac Heat Pump might be tripping the circuit breaker because the breaker isn't correctly sized or the cable section used is not the right one. Also, the supply voltage could be too low; in this case, contact your electricity supplier.

    What to do if my Zodiac Z200 M3 Heat Pump is not working?
    • B
      Brandon ParkSep 2, 2025
      If your Zodiac Heat Pump isn't working, check the supply voltage and the F1 fuse. Also, the heat pump stops heating when the setpoint temperature is reached: the water temperature is higher than or equal to the setpoint temperature. If the water flow rate is zero or not enough, the heat pump stops: ensure water is circulating correctly. The heat pump also stops when the outdoor temperature falls below 5 °C for standard models or -5 °C for “Defrost” models. Finally, it may have detected an operating fault.

    What to do if my Zodiac Heat Pump is working but the water temperature does not increase?
    • C
      Cristian GonzalezSep 5, 2025
      If your Zodiac Heat Pump is running but the water temperature isn't increasing, it may have detected an operating fault. Check that the automatic filling valve is not stuck in the open position, as this will keep supplying cold water. If the air is cool, install a heat-insulated cover on your pool to reduce heat loss. Also, if the evaporator is clogged with dirt, clean it to restore performance. Ensure the external environment isn't hindering the heat pump and that the heat pump is the right size for your pool and environment.

    Why is my Zodiac Z200 M3 Heat Pump draining water?
    • T
      tiffanyestesSep 8, 2025
      The water draining from your Zodiac Heat Pump is often condensation, which is moisture in the air condensing on cold components, especially the evaporator. To check if it's a pool circuit leak, shut down the heat pump, wait a few minutes, and run the filtration pump to circulate water. If water continues to flow through the condensation drain, there is a water leak, and you should contact your reseller.

    Why does my Zodiac Z200 M3 not start heating straight away?
    • J
      jonescharlesSep 12, 2025
      Your Zodiac Heat Pump might not start heating immediately because it remains paused for 5 minutes on start-up. Also, when the setpoint temperature is reached, the heat pump stops heating if the water temperature is higher than or equal to the setpoint temperature. If the water flow rate is zero or insufficient, the heat pump will stop; check that water is circulating correctly and that hydraulic connections are correct. The heat pump also stops if the outdoor temperature falls below 5 °C for standard models or -5 °C for “Defrost” models. Finally, it may have detected an operating fault.
